Going to be doing a bunch of marching band recordings outside this fall, and I was wondering if anyone has ever used something like Scotch Guard on furry rat type windscreens and found it effective.  If so, are there any potential negative effects on the windscreen from doing this?  I'm not expecting actual waterproofing, just some protection from a light drizzle on damp October nights.

Found this on the Rycote website:

Q. Can I treat my Windjammer with water repellent to make it waterproof?
A.  The Windjammer material is already treated with a very fine layer of Scotchguard, but adding any further quantities can result in a crackling noise being heard. Water repellents may also seriously degrade the HF transparency of the backing, so we really would not recommend it.

I don't know if other brands use water repellent material.
Rycote & RemoteAudio also sell real rain covers, they're maybe even DIY-able..

I've sprayed the outside of foam screens and rats with silicone water repellant.  I find it mostly just makes it easier to shake water off them, rather than really keeping them from becoming wet.  I mostly did it just to make them slightly more hydrophobic so they'd have less tendency to wick wetness towards the microphones as easily.

It didn't seem to gunk them up.  Took a few hours to dry and was then basically unnoticeable.  I did the 'hold it against my ear and listen' test before and after and heard no differences in high frequency attenuation.

I'll let you know when I find out. :)  This season is the first I'll be bringing full size mics with me to marching band shows.  Most professional companies I see that record the final shows of the competition circuit for DVD production use an X/Y cardiod pair on a very tall stand at the 50, just in front of the stands.  Then they have 1 or 2 pairs of omni outriggers flanking the X/Y pair at around the 10 and 30 yard lines on either side.  I on the other hand have to do this more run-and-gun style with just one pair of mics, as I only have the capability to record 2 channels.

For home games, I have access to the press box roof since I'm on staff.  When I record, I am running video and audio together and that tends to be the best location for video to capture the whole band from a fixed camera angle (although quite distant for audio).  So if I'm up there, I'm going to experiment the first couple of times - one show I'll run the omnis clamped to the railing spaced as far as I can, probably about 15-20 feet.  The next time I'll try my cards in NOS (especially since my cards are really almost subcards).  In this situation I have plenty of time to set up carefully, and usually the only other person who might be up there is a video guy for the football team.

For away games and competitions, I'll be able to be either in the stands or on the field directly in front of the band, but definitely not above the press box.  If I'm on the field, that means I'm also on the schlepping crew for the pit equipment (podium, mallet instruments, synths, tympani, etc.).  In that situation, it's a very much run-and-gun situation and I'll need to have everything set up very compact on a monopod with a flash bracket and various attachments. 

If I'm in the stands as an audience member, I'll probably go with my cards in NOS clamped to bar if I'm right in front in the first row of stands.  Otherwise, I'll again be holding up the whole thing on my monopod / flash bracket setup.  I wouldn't use my omnis in that situation because I wouldn't have the space or time to spread them appropriately.

With miniature omnis, boundary mounted to a vertical wall, I simply gaff tape them in place directly to the surface, no stand or mounts required.  I do have some hard rubber boundary mounts made for the minature DPA omnis which work nicely and protect them from being crushed if accidentally stepped on when used on the floor.  The rubber mounts can similary be taped to a wall or even a person.

Rocks, your construction looks similar to this recommended Shopes accessory: http://www.schoeps.de/en/schoeps-recommends/turtle, which both suspends the microphone using elastic bands to eliminate solid-born handling noise (vibration transmitted through the floor) and offers protection from being trampled upon, although it looks like the capsule portion protrudes from the protective housing and is vulnerable.  That can be used for directional microphones as well as omnis, and that blue superCMIT shotgun sticking out right at foot level looks very vulnerable to me!

You want to get the capsule as close as possible to the surface for best results.  I've used non-minature omnis placed directly on neoprene rubber 'mouse-pads' laying on the floor with a sandbag (actually they were lead-shot bags) on top, which damped vibrations and also protected the microphones.  Obviously the capsule has to protrude enough not to be obscured by the sandbag, and the polar pattern to the rear is somewhat modified by the sandbag.

Volt, for boundary mounted recording of the marching band out on the field, you'd want a vertical boundary like a wall that faces the field. You might be able to setup two stands right up against a large wall facing the field, and arrange the mic stands so the microphone capsules are only a 1/4" or so from the wall surface, facing upwards or to either side.  With foam windscreens on the mics you could push them right up against the wall.  If both omnis are mounted on the same wall, then you'll want to space them as you would A-B omnis in free space.  If you had a triangular wall corner that points towards the center of the field (doubtful, but who knows), or are using two pieces of  perspex (plexiglass) or plywood or a couple folding tables or whatever as boundary surfaces which you can arrange however you like (anything hard, flat and large enough will work, the larger the better, 4' square or even more is best) you could arrange the microphones closer together with the two surfaces angled away from each other like directional microphones.  That will introduce more level difference and less time of arrival differences between channels. 

If you'd rather not hear them marching left and right in the resulting image, back and forth to opposite ends of the field, spacing them A-B more widely on one surface will get that open spaced omni bigness and ambience (appropriate for this I think) without such hard panned imaging effects.

I do think boundary mounted omnis may be a good choice for a marching band on a field if you are recording from the pressbox.  The technique seems to be very good at providing good clarity while minimizing ambient reverberance when recording from a far distance.

I actually got this from a broadcast sound engineer friend - the TV company had the contract to broadcast American Football and the previous company refused to say how they miked it.

So, he used a couple of boundary mics on perspex panels (the suze to get the bass end and perspex so they were see-through and were not too obvious to the crowd).

I think they were held by a person and only used while the marching band was on the pitch.

The results were far better than the previous broadcaster had realised by using many mics.

Yeah the closer the better for an even response across all frequencies down to the lower limit imposed by the area of the boundary itself.

The closer the diaphragm is to the boundary, the higher in frequency the effect manifests as boundary reinforcement rather than comb filtering coloration.  But in practical terms I'm not sure how much that really matters.  Tapers record all the time with microphones on low stands 6" to a couple feet above the surface of the stage around here without major issues lower in frequency.  Even a normal height mic-stand is within the boundary reinforcement zone at the lowest frequencies.   Most everyone here will be familiar with the subjective difference in level of the subwoofers compared to the rest of the spectrum at highly amplified venues when standing up verses sitting down, the low end can get deafening closer to the floor, especially when going from standing to sitting directly on the ground outside at a festival.  That’s lower frequency boundary effect.

When I started placing mics just a few inches above the stage for recording acoustic jazz to minimize my visual impact, I was initially concerned about combing from reflections bouncing off the highly reflective wooden floor but never had any audible issues. [edit- sometimes that inculded LD microphones oriented sideways in their shock mounts, mostly to get the desired spacing I wanted, but that orientaion also placed them lower, with the diaphrams about 2-1/2 inches above the floor surface.]

More on the guitar and ceiling fan thing- when I first I took notice of that and realized what was going on, my next thought was that it was an excellent example of making something consciously noticeable which normally isn't, even if it is always quite easily measurable and most definitely effecting timbre. The effects of the room boundaries and reflections off nearby surfaces like the ceiling and fan blades unquestionably affect the sound of the guitar in the room.  But it normally only becomes obvious when moving to different rooms or listening to recordings made in different rooms.  Likewise the effects on timbre are of the same magnitude but aren’t consciously perceptible with the fan off, although they are very obvious and objectionable with the blades moving causing audible comb-shifting.  A static comb-filter may not be a problem even though it may be strong and easily measureable. It could be but it isn’t always, and I haven’t found it very problematic when I’ve placed mics near static boundaries recording live music performaces.

years ago (early 1980's) my mentor (Mark Fitzgerald-Rosewood Sound-Syracuse NY) used to do Sound reinforcement for several large Irish music festivals (e.g. Caeili Music festival-Philly PA). We were his pupils at SU and did a lot of work for him from 1981-1984; one of the festivals asked him to provide "better" reinforcement for the dancers/cloggers. He decided to go with the Crown PZMs and we would place them near the running lights at the stage lip.we tried facing them with different geometrical locations including upside down. Of course, upside down wasn't the greatest, but we tried it all. We had several dancers step on the mics accidentally and accept for the transient bump from the PA, the mics survived. Spilling Guiness Beer inside one may have damaged it, however, it still worked after we dried it out.
For the marhcing band, I would tend toward these PZM's on plexi-glass, maybe 4-6 of them on stands with maybe some shotguns stationed at mid field angled toward the 25 yard lines. I have seen Teevee productions where the band is in the stands and they have mics (I assume cards) aimed at the band usually 2-4 mics spread out in front. At SU, they used to mic us (I was in the marching band-not doing PA) with SM57s across the front row with an extra one or two closer to the woodwinds when we were in the stands. But of course, this was just for reinforcement not for recording.

Here's a link to a page with lots of bundary-mounting info, including most of the old authoritive Crown document, which does a good job describing what's going on including the combfiltering effect Jon mentions and describes some interesting multi-planar boundarires.  The full Crown PDF is linked there, which as I recall also includes the mathematical formulas for calculating the effect of specific boundary-areas and such.  The page linked here primarily deals with nature recording, and shows lots of small DIY stereo baffles similar to the Crown SASS below the Crown document info.  Those things will only leverage the boundary-effect and act  directionally at high frequencies due to the small area of their boundaries.

Does your camcorder have a shotgun or other type of directional mic?  Because then you could have been having proximity effect issues with it picking up the reflections off of close boundaries.  Even if that wasn't happening, at the distance that the mic probably was from said boundaries, you could have been getting all kinds of comb filtering / phase cancellation.  As described by Jon and Gutbucket earlier, a real boundary application means the capsule is very close to the boundary to both maximize the boundary effect and also avoid the comb filtering you get at intermediate distances.  Combine that with auto gain and things could get pretty dicey.

What usually sounds somewhat odd to me in most 'marching band on a field' recordings (not that I hear that many of them) is the timbre and sonic space around the percussion elements.  The percussion's restricted frequency range, dynamics and ambience with a very quickly tapering reverberant tail usually translates to me as an unusual 'dry and bottled' sense of excess distance.   Melodic tone instruments seem less effected by distance in those ways to me, although they have the same thing going on acoustically.  It's mostly that percussion aspect that I suspect may benefit from the diffuse field decorellation of widely spaced omnis.  I think it would sort of better place all the sounds and especially the percussion in a more appropriate sounding 'space', even if that space is somewhat of an artificial 'cheat' produced by the spaced omnis.  It may sound more natural and pleasing for the average listener even though it may well be less faithful to what one would actually hear live, standing there.

But as you just mention, the intended purpose of the recordings may be different and the more important factor in this situation.  The audience for these recordings isn’t average listeners listening for enjoyment, but expert listeners listening critically to their own performance and overall sound.  If these recordings are primarily intended as tools used by the students to asses and modify their performance, based on what it sounds like to listeners in the stands watching them perform on the field, then a technique that conveys that experience as authentically as possible is more appropriate than a technique that may produce a generally more pleasing recording for speaker playback.

With that in mind, a jecklin disk, HRTF head recording or even a binaural setup might be appropriate if the students are mostly listening on headphones.

In this particular instance, they weren't in a stadium, but were on a wide-open grass practice lawn way in front of the school, so there was absolutely nothing reflective for the percussion to couple with.  That's not normal for this type of group, and may be part of the reason my recording sounds much drier on those instruments than you would expect.  In a stadium, that will be a different story.  Even the turf field makes a difference.  While it's not really reflective, it is much less absorptive than grass.  And you're right that the other instruments have the advantage in this situation.  This band also doesn't have a very big drumline compared to the other sections.

Hey Voltronic, I have been recording marching bands for what seems like forever and thought I would share what I've learned (and btw have learned some great stuff from reading this thread!). I have gone through a lot of mic/recorder combinations, and have been using the AT853 mics for awhile and they are great for the price, and pick up a pretty good spectrum. Sometimes I have to go in through post-processing and cut a bit of bass, but not a big deal.

Think about this...marching bands are designed to be enjoyed primarily from the 50 yard line. That doesn't mean anything else is a bad seat, but someone sitting on the 50 yard line will get the full picture, both audio and visual wise. What does that mean? A pair of stereo mics on the 50 yard line is plenty. There is no real need to add any mics on wider yard lines. DCI (a professional marching band competition circuit for lack of better explanation, which is drum and bugle corps) has screwed up their audio recordings too many times to count. They get screwed up drumline wise (I'm a drumline guy, I pay a lot of attention to this!). When you have a stereo pair on the 50, then add another stereo pair 15 yards out, then you are dealing with sound phase between the microphones. The sound phase REALLY screws up snare and quad sounds, makes them sound like they are playing out of time (or playing dirty!).

So when you watch a marching band, if you want the best listening experience, where do you sit? If you ask 99% of the band people out there, they will say sitting on the 50 yard line in the first couple rows. And I agree. So, your mics should be placed there, or as close to there as possible. Ideally, right in front of the first row is perfect. How high should the mics be? Again, think about what the shows are designed for. The shows are usually designed for the judges in the pressbox, so the horn angles point their sound to the press box. The balance of the brass, woodwinds, drumline and pit are all keyed into making it sound good in the pressbox. So, the mics should be high enough to be almost in the line of sight of the judges as they are looking down from the press box to the field.

I believe cardioid patterns are best, as they are wide enough to get the full ensemble sound, but they reject crowd noise from behind the mics. Hypers can be bad, because they will get whatever instrument they are pointing at the loudest. I have heard XY patterns, I don't think they sound good for this application. 90 degree mic angle with about 19cm spacing sounds good.

Voltronic, I know that sometimes you don't have control over where you set up. If you have to stand on the track, you can still get a decent recording. If you get to go in the stands, front row on the 50 yard line is best.  I have a couple samples that I will post when I get a chance. My recording gear all fits in a backpack, I hit record well before it's performance time, and so when the show is ready to go, I pull the mics out of the bag, and just hold them for 10 minutes.

A light stand (designed for holding lights for photography) is the most common type of stand used for recording around here.  It is basically much more like a camera tripod than a traditional microphone stand, but has fixed instead of telescoping legs, making it much simpler and faster to setup, though it provides less leveling adjustments.  Instead of a hand-cranked top tube for fine adjustment of height, they have simple multi-sectioned telescopic vertical tube section which clamp in place. They are available from about 12" to up to to 25'+ tall. Similarly to a camera tripod, the diameter of the footprint can be adjusted as to be wider for for more stability or narrower for a smaller and more compact footprint, at the risk of being less stable.

That light-stand I'm using and a few other small ones are designed so that the legs fold upwards (over center, with the feet ending up at the top), which allows for a shorter stowed length about the length of each leg.  Most light-stands stow with the legs folded downwards (feet at the bottom), so they stow longer than the length of each leg.

The green balls at the bottom (and also the ones acting as the spherical baffles for the omnis microphones) are light but dense, solid closed-cell foam balls used in Nerf brand toy guns, sold in packs of 6 or 8 as 'ballistics balls'.  I bought them at a local Toys-R-Us. Used as replacement stand feet, they help keep the stand from sinking into soft soil or sand, and provide some cushioning on hard concrete surfaces as we visual indication.  I just made used a razor knife to make a slit in the balls that was about the width of each leg and about 3/4 of the way deep into the ball and slipped one onto each leg.  For the spherical microphone baffles, I melted holes of the appropirate size through them with the head of a heated nail and painted them charcoal 'Nextel' grey with a spray can of upholstery paint from an automotive store.

If you can't find those particular green Nerf Balistic Balls I prefer, I've seen balls made of the same material in sporting goods stores, in a slightly smaller diameter and usually yellow in color, sold as floating practice golf balls and outdoor ping-pong balls (or maybe paddle balls).

1. Having the mics pre-set in the mount / clamp setup is definitely the way to go for these time-pressure situations, but since these mics need a wider spacing it's difficult to fit the assembled rig in a bag.  I compromised by having the full setup pre-cabled and mounting rig attached to the superclamp, so all I had to do was clamp onto a rail and slide in the mics.

2. Contradicting #1 a bit, if I know ahead of time that I'll be recording from the sideline / track area, I can use a stereo bar with narrower spacing pre-set with the mics as opposed to my DIY NOS mount which is a bit bulky.

3. The TBrown Muppets are fantastic windscreens, but I need to remember to bring some hair bands or other way of securing them (with the foam underneath) tighter on these mics.  A couple shows were VERY windy and thought I thought the screens were going to take off.  Every year our November shows are extremely windy.

4. One show got moved indoors to a HS gym because of the weather.  I knew this ahead of time but only brought my omnis simply because they are much cheaper to replace if they got wet during the unload.  I should have used the CM3s.  The gym was half the size I expected it to be which made it even more boomy than anticipated. 

5. A couple shows I decided not to bring my recording rig because someone else was recording or there was a "professional" setup.  I now know that I should always bring mine.
